.title-brand{font-family:var(--joy-font-family-title);font-weight:500;line-height:var(--joy-line-height-small);font-size:40px;margin-bottom:var(--joy-core-spacing-4)}.title-brand h1,.title-brand h2{font-size:inherit;font-weight:inherit}@media screen and (min-width:768px){.title-brand{font-weight:500;font-size:var(--joy-font-size-secondary-400);line-height:var(--joy-line-height-small);font-family:var(--joy-font-family-title);margin-bottom:var(--joy-core-spacing-9)}}@media screen and (min-width:1200px){.title-brand{font-size:52px}}.title-brand strong{display:inline-block;position:relative;z-index:1;font-weight:500;font-family:var(--joy-font-family-title);line-height:var(--joy-line-height-small);color:var(--joy-color-neutral-0);padding:0 .25em}.title-brand strong:before{content:"";display:inline-block;position:absolute;left:0;top:-.09em;height:1em;width:100%;background-color:var(--joy-color-brand-primary-50);border-radius:9999px;z-index:-1}.title-brand--starts-with-strong strong:first-child{margin-left:-.25em}
